Transponder chips are present in car key fobs that communicate with the internal computer system in your car. If you own a newer model car, it's likely your key fob is equipped with this type of chip. The technician will insert a blank transponder into your key and program it to match the settings of your car's systems. Some cars permit the owner to perform their own reprogramming, this usually requires specialized equipment. It is recommended to consult the manual of your vehicle to find out how to do it. If you don't have access the manual the locksmith is likely to be able program your car key fob for you. You could also return to your dealer and have your keys programmed. Misplaced Car Keys Car keys are small and can fit into just about every purse and pocket which makes them among the most easily lost items. In automotive key programming near me , it's estimated that the average person loses their car keys at least once per year.1 This is why it is crucial for drivers to always have an extra in the event of an emergency. Unlike older, non-transponder keys the majority of modern vehicles have transponder chips inside their keys, which communicate with your vehicle's computer to allow you to unlock or start the engine. Fortunately, the majority of these keys can be replaced and programmed at a locksmith or programmer near you. Using an online search for a key programmer, like 'car key programmer near me', will assist you in finding the right firm to complete the task quickly and efficiently. The process of programming a new key can be simple, but it may vary slightly based on the car and the manufacturer. You can often find the specific instructions for your car in its owner's manual. In most cases, you'll have to insert the keys and switch it on and off repeatedly to set it up correctly. You'll have to visit a dealer to program the key for the most recent cars. This is because certain manufacturers use a security system which ensures only their dealers can create new keys. They are unable to be copied by locksmiths.
